The Ferrari 365 GT 2+2 (1967-1971) -- sometimes referred to as the Queen Mother -- was the last of the dry sump 60 degree sohc V12 Ferrari 2+2s. It was succeeded by the 365 GTC/4 (1971-1972). In a cost-engineering move Ferrari put a *wet* sump 60 degree V12 in this one, albeit with double overhead cams. To reduce overall height the intake ports sit between the cams, using six side draft Webers. All came with a 5-spd manual gearbox. The wedge shaped 2+2, of which the 400i is one, began with the 365 GT4 2+2 (1972-1976). They carried forward the wet sump dohc V12, as well as the 5-speed stick. The 400 GT/400 Automatic (1976-1979) grew the engine by 420 cc and added the option of a GM Turbo Hydramatic 3-spd slushbox. The 400i (1979-1984) swapped out the six side-draft Webers for Bosch K-Jetronic fuel injection, a mechanical setup which, like a lawn sprinkler system, has all 12 injectors running full time, with mixture control handled by a plate on a lever floating up and down in the intake tract. The sub 5-liter engines in the 365 GT4 2+2 and 400s were no match for their two ton weight, with 0-60 in the 7's. Where they excel is in freeway -- or Autobahn/Autostrada -- cruising. Interesting fact about the Boss 429 Mustangs................................. the stock engine compartment wasn't wide enough for the engine to fit, so Ford sent the cars to Kar Kraft in Dearborn for them to modify the compartment to fit the motor.

Iso's were incredible cars. Italian style with dependable American V8 powertrains. They were very well engineered cars. The BMW Isetta started as an Iso but was much more improved on. I settable in Italian is little Iso. Iso was a manufacturer of appliances and other products before they took the leap to automobiles. They should demand higher prices for their rarity alone but sadly don't have the name recognition of brands like Ferrari.
